While both powder and liquid forms share similar anionicity and molecular weight, our Liquid Anionic Polyelectrolytes offer a distinct advantage in solution preparation time for facilities in Amritsar. Their fluid form allows for rapid dispersion and activation, making them ideal for automated dosing systems where time and consistency are critical for regional operations.

The performance of these polymer flocculants is enhanced by superior copolymerization techniques and a robust polymer chain structure. This ensures highly effective performance across various wastewater characters in Amritsar, providing a reliable alternative to traditional powder-grade polyelectrolytes.
